WebMember Relocation Clearance Process. The Family Member Relocation Clearance process is critical for determining availability of services for family members with special needs when relocating. The process has been revised and streamlined to ensure a more understandable and customer friendly approach. ...

WebWhen families of active duty or civilian sponsors relocate at government expense, the Family Members' Relocation Clearance process determines the availability of services for spouses and children prior to arrival at the new locations. All active duty sponsors who have dependent family members with medical or special education needs that meet ... WebFeb 22, 2014 · The Family Member Relocation Clearance (FMRC) is mandatory for all family members traveling. OCONUS and for all special needs family members traveling CONUS in conjunction with sponsor’s. PCS. This process is used to ensure specialized care/services are available at the projected gaining. location.
